> How does this scheme deal with multiple versions?
> Say I (not trustworthy, remember!) cerate a document. Then Dave approves
> it for publishing. Then I edit it. At this ponit, the old version should
> be visible on the site. Then Dave approves the new version, at which
> point the old one should go away (or be kept in version history,
> probably) and the new one should be published.
That's why I suggest external pub_id, which is persistent and publicly
available id, and msg_id - another one for versionning. Then we need
mapping between pub_id and msg_id. In our CMS we have versions and revisions,
but I don't think it's needed here.
